Delta University of Science and Technology (DSUST) Courses
1. Faculty of Agriculture
- Animal Production
- Agricultural Economics
- Soil Science
- Crop Science
2. Faculty of Science
- Biological Sciences
- Chemical Sciences
- Physics
- Mathematics
- Statistics
3. Faculty of Earth Science
- Geology
- Marine Science
- Environmental Management and Toxicology
- Petroleum Chemistry
4. Faculty of Engineering
- Mechanical Engineering
- Civil Engineering
- Computer Engineering
- Chemical Engineering
- Marine Engineering
- Agricultural Engineering
- Petroleum and Gas Engineering
- Electrical Engineering
- Material and Metallurgical Engineering
5. Faculty of Environmental Science
- Architecture
- Estate Management
- Quantity Surveying
- Surveying and Geoinformatics
- Building Technology
- Environmental Management
- Urban and Regional Planning
- Fine and Applied Arts
- Industrial Design
6. Faculty of Information Technology
- Computer Science
- Cyber Security
- Software Engineering
- Information System and Technology
- Journalism and Media Studies
- Library and Information Science
7. Faculty of Management Technology
- Accounting
- Banking and Finance
- Marketing
- Business Administration
- Entrepreneurship
- Transport and Marine Management
- Office and Information Management
- Public Administration
